AIX是一款常用的操作系統,而Oracle是一款常用的數據庫管理系統。在使用Oracle時,我們有時需要查看數據庫的歸檔情況。下面就來介紹一下在AIX操作系統下,如何查看Oracle數據庫的歸檔。
首先,我們需要登錄到Oracle數據庫中。在命令行中輸入以下命令:
sqlplus / as sysdba
這個命令可以讓我們以管理員的身份登錄到數據庫中。
接下來,我們就可以查看歸檔日志文件的狀態了。在命令行中輸入以下命令:
archive log list
這個命令會列出數據庫中所有的歸檔日志文件,并顯示它們的狀態。
例如,我們可能會看到以下的輸出:
Database log mode Archive Mode Automatic archival Enabled Archive destination /oracle/arch Oldest online log sequence 17 Next log sequence to archive 19 Current log sequence 19
從輸出中可以看到,數據庫處于歸檔模式,并且歸檔日志文件會被自動歸檔到/oracle/arch這個目錄中。
如果我們想要手動歸檔一個日志文件,可以使用以下命令:
alter system archive log current;
這個命令會將當前的日志文件歸檔到歸檔目錄中。
除此之外,我們還可以使用以下命令來查看已經被歸檔的日志文件:
select * from v$archived_log;
這個命令會列出已經被歸檔的日志文件的信息,包括日志文件的路徑、大小、歸檔時間等等。
總之,在AIX操作系統下,通過使用以上的命令,我們可以很方便地查看Oracle數據庫的歸檔情況。這對于數據庫管理員來說,是非常重要的一項工作。